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: How long does a roofline installation take?
A: The period depends upon the size of the task, the materials used, and weather. The majority of setups can be finished within a day or 2.
Q2: What are the signs that I need a roofline installation?
A: Common indications consist of drooping or damaged gutters, rotting wood, peeling paint, or leaks in your house.
